Transaction 5b81c973b9800794a021a5cd57965a530e23388a5eed7a2e0cbe59324720498b
1 Input
2 Outputs
- 5b81c973b9800794a021a5cd57965a530e23388a5eed7a2e0cbe59324720498b:0
- 5b81c973b9800794a021a5cd57965a530e23388a5eed7a2e0cbe59324720498b:1
value 1257047
address 162FXTWWDTuEuaVsDXwdXgsDV1wVSvboTB
value 2953567
address 1A5bUArjr7nfsPWq3fX8qMrtHrpkivMRyb